flowable自动建表配置
时间: 2023-10-06 07:10:48 浏览: 71
关于Flowable自动建表配置,你可以在Flowable的配置文件中进行相关设置。以下是一种常见的配置方式:
1. 打开Flowable的配置文件(如flowable.cfg.xml或flowable.properties)。
2. 找到数据库相关的配置项,一般是以jdbc开头的配置项,如jdbc-url、jdbc-driver、jdbc-username等。
3. 根据你使用的数据库类型,填写对应的数据库连接信息,确保数据库驱动已经添加到项目的依赖中。
4. 在配置项中设置 `db-schema-update` 的值为 `true`。这会告诉Flowable在启动时自动创建数据库表。
5. 可选:如果你希望Flowable自动更新数据库表结构(如增加新的流程定义、任务等),你可以将 `db-schema-update` 设置为 `true` 或 `create-drop`。`create-drop` 会在每次启动时删除并重新创建数据库表。
请注意,在生产环境中,建议使用手动建表的方式,以便更好地控制和管理数据库结构。
相关问题
flowable自动建表逻辑
flowable自动建表逻辑是根据不同的模块进行表的创建。根据flowable的命名规则,可以将表根据前缀进行分类。
ACT_RE_开头的表是repository存储的表,包含流程定义和流程的资源信息。
ACT_RU_开头的表是runtime运行时的表,存储着流程变量、用户任务、变量、职责等运行时的数据。这些表在流程实例结束时会被删除。
ACT_ID_开头的表是identity(组织机构)相关的表,包含用户、用户组等信息。
ACT_HI_开头的表是history历史相关的表,包含结束的流程实例、变量、任务等历史数据。
ACT_GE_开头的表是普通数据表,用于存储各种情况下都使用的数据。
flowable可选配置
Flowable的可选配置有以下几项:
1. 在flowable.cfg.xml文件中必须包含一个id为’processEngineConfiguration’的bean,其class可以有四个选择,分别对应四个环境。
2. 配置邮件服务器是可选的。Flowable支持在业务流程中发送电子邮件。要真正发送电子邮件,需要有效的SMTP邮件服务器配置。
3. 历史配置也是可选的。可以选择是否记录全部的历史数据,包括流程实例、任务、变量等。
4. Flowable允许选择您的选择的日志实施,所有日志记录(包括Flowable、Spring、MyBatis等)通过SLF4J路由。
这些可选配置可以根据具体的需求来进行配置和调整,以满足不同业务流程的要求。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* [flowable学习(Ⅱ) ----Flowable的流程引擎配置](https://blog.csdn.net/weixin_44122500/article/details/91816621)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"]
- *2* *3* [Flowable入门系列文章9 - 基本配置三](https://blog.csdn.net/qq_30739519/article/details/120506786)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"]
[ .reference_list ]